The Complex Reality of Keeping Exotic Animals The allure of unique animals has actually recorded human fascination for centuries From the majestic charm of a Bengal tiger to the colorful plumage of a macaw these animals often appear as the epitome of luxury and adventure Nevertheless the decision to keep exotic animals as animals raises various ethical legal and practical considerations This blog site post intends to explore the intricacies surrounding the ownership of unique animals going over both the fascinating appeal and the inherent difficulties
The Appeal of Exotic Pets Numerous individuals are drawn to unique animals for numerous factors
Unique Companionship Exotic family pets provide a kind of friendship that differs considerably from standard pets like canines and cats Their unusual habits and striking looks can offer novelty and enjoyment
Status Symbol Owning an unique animal can be viewed as a status symbol typically forecasting prestige and wealth This is particularly relevant in social circles where originality is highly valued
Educational Value For some keeping unique animals can cause a deeper understanding of wildlife biology and conservation efforts It can be a chance to educate others about these creatures and the environments they come from
The Ethical and Legal Considerations While the appeal of unique family pets is attracting potential owners should navigate a host of ethical and legal issues
Ethical Concerns Welfare of the Animal Exotic animals often have particular habitat dietary and social needs that are challenging to fulfill in a home setting Preservation Impact The unique family pet trade can add to the decrease of wild populations pressing specific species more detailed to extinction HumanAnimal Bond The bond formed with an exotic pet can be complicated as these animals might not be domesticated and can exhibit unforeseeable behaviors Legal Considerations The legality of keeping unique animals varies significantly by area It is vital to research study regional laws and policies which may consist of

1 Specialized Care Requirements Exotic family pets may require special diet plans and environments to prosper For instance reptiles may need particular heating and humidity levels while birds frequently require ample flight space and social interaction
2 Cost Implications The cost of owning an unique animal can be substantially higher than that of traditional animals Expenditures can consist of
Initial Purchase Price Exotic animals frequently have greater purchase rates due to rarity Veterinary Care Finding a vet who specializes in unique animals can be tough and their services might come at a premium Environment Setup Creating an appropriate living environment can be costly particularly for bigger types 3 Behavioral Issues Unique animals might show unpredictable behaviors especially if they feel threatened or worried Comprehending their psychology and social needs is important for effective ownership

Research Thoroughly research study the species including its natural environment habits and particular care needs
Consult Professionals Engage with veterinarians who focus on exotic animals and consult from experienced owners or breeders
Assess Your Lifestyle Consider whether your lifestyle allows for the level of care and dedication needed for an unique animal
Think about Conservation Opt for species that are reproduced in captivity instead of taken from the wild This supports conservation efforts and decreases the effect on wild populations
Prepare for the Long Term Exotic animals can live for lots of years ensure youre prepared for a longlasting commitment
While the idea of keeping an exotic animal may seem appealing it is important to approach the decision with caution and informed awareness The ethical legal and practical obstacles related to unique family pet ownership can be considerable It is crucial for prospective owners to prioritize the wellness of the animal and think about the impact of their options on wildlife preservation

Q2 What kinds of exotic animals are best for beginners Smaller less requiring species like particular reptiles or little mammals such as sugar gliders might be preferable for novices
Q3 How can I guarantee the wellness of my unique pet Research specific care requirements offer an ideal environment and guarantee routine veterinary checkups with a professional experienced in dealing with exotic animals
Q4 What should I do if I can no longer care for my unique animal Contact a local animal rescue or wildlife rehab program that specializes in exotic animals for guidance on accountable rehoming
